Bihar Assembly Election 2025: Dates Announced, Battle Lines Drawn The Election Commission of India has officially unveiled the schedule for the much-anticipated Bihar Assembly Election 2025, setting the stage for a high-stakes political showdown in one of India’s most dynamic states. With 243 constituencies up for grabs, the electoral calendar is now locked—and the countdown has begun. 📅 Election Timeline The election will be conducted in two phases: Phase 1 Voting: November 6, 2025 Covers 121 constituencies across northern and central Bihar, including Patna, Muzaffarpur, and Gaya. Phase 2 Voting: November 11, 2025 Encompasses the remaining 122 constituencies, including Bhagalpur, Darbhanga, and Purnia. Counting of Votes: November 14, 2025 Results will be declared, determining the next government of Bihar.
